AI Fraud Detection Software Development: Why Enterprises Are Replacing Rule-Based Systems

Posted on June 9, 2026 by admin

Imagine a scenario in which a customer’s card gets blocked during a genuine purchase. After a few minutes, a genuine fraudulent transaction goes unnoticed.

This is no longer an occasional issue but a daily operational challenge for many enterprises globally.

Earlier, rule-based fraud detection systems were designed for predictable fraud patterns, but today, modern fraudsters use AI, automation, and rapidly changing attack methods to stay ahead.

Over time, companies suffer missed threats, increasing financial losses, customer dissatisfaction, and an increase in false positive detections.

To eliminate the issue, companies from the insurance, banking, and payments sectors, etc are turning to AI-powered fraud detection solutions in 2026.

These enterprise fraud detection systems analyze behavior in real-time, detect abnormalities, and adapt to evolving fraud patterns, unlike static rule engines.

In this blog, we’ll explore how an AI fraud detection software work, their key features, development process, costs, and why enterprises are replacing traditional rule-based systems in 2026.

Here, you will explore how an AI fraud detection system works, the steps to build it, the key features, and the cost to develop an AI-powered fraud detection system.

Let’s get started by understanding an A-powered fraud detection platform.

What is an AI Fraud Detection Software?

A smart security system that helps businesses identify suspicious activities before they turn into financial losses is known as an AI fraud detection system or a real-time fraud detection.

Such a system doesn’t rely only on fixed rules; instead, they study

  • User behavior
  • Transaction patterns
  • Device activity
  • Account history in real-time

This helps the system to detect unusual actions. For example, the system flags it for review when a customer suddenly makes a high-value transaction from an unknown location or device.

The best thing about AI or machine learning fraud detection software is that it continuously improves by learning from new fraud attempts. This helps fintech companies, banks, payment processors, and insurers to detect evolving threats faster while reducing false alarms and improving customer experience.

How Does an AI Fraud Detection Platform Work?

AI fraud detection systems work by continuously tracking user behavior, transactions, device information, login activity, and payment patterns in real-time.

By comparing every action with past behavior, the platform identifies unusual activities or hidden fraud signals.

For example, if a customer who usually makes small local purchases suddenly attempts multiple high-value international transactions within minutes, the platform will identify the unusual behavior and calculate the fraud risk score.

Examine the image to understand the working procedure more clearly:

AI-driven fraud detection systems become more accurate by learning from new fraud attempts over time. This helps businesses detect threats faster while reducing false positives.

Now that we have learned how an AI-powered fraud detection platform works, it’s time to understand the development procedure of the software.

How to Build an AI Fraud Detection Platform in 2026?

You need more than machine learning models in your existing systems or new ones to develop intelligent enterprise fraud detection software.

Your enterprise requires a structured approach to detect modern fraud patterns accurately and efficiently. This can be possible with right AI development solutions, behavioural intelligence, real-time analytics, security, and continuous learning.

Let’s discover the 9 steps to develop AI and machine learning fraud detection software in 2026:

1:Identify Fraud Risks and Business Objectives

First, you must understand the type of fraud you want to prevent, which may include

  • Payment fraud
  • Identify theft
  • Account takeover
  • Insurance fraud
  • Transaction laundering
  • Synthetic identity fraud

Apart from that, evaluate false positive rates, fraud detection gaps, regulatory requirements, and customer friction. Having a clear understanding of business goals will help you define the platform’s accuracy, response speed, and compliance requirements.

2:Collect and Prepare Real-Time Data

Collect and organize data from multiple sources, like

  • Transaction history
  • Login activity
  • User behavior
  • Device details
  • Location insights
  • Payment patterns

Companies need to remove any duplicate/wrong records, detect missing data in the data set, and reshape the data to be used in training the model. Keep in mind that clean data decreases false positives, increases accuracy in fraud detection, and assists the AI fraud detection software in detecting suspicious activity.

3:Build Behavioral Analysis Models

Creating behavioral analysis models is crucial; therefore, training the system to understand normal customer behavior and to identify unusual activities is imperative. This helps in detecting suspicious spending patterns or abnormal account actions in real-time as well.

With new fraud attempts and transaction patterns, this model continuously improves over time. This results in helping enterprises detect evolving threats faster and minimize false alerts and unwanted transaction declines.

4:Develop a Real-Time Risk Scoring Engine

Developing a real-time fraud detection system demands a risk scoring mechanism that evaluates every transaction based on multiple factors like

  • Behavior
  • Transaction value
  • Device usage
  • Account activity
  • Other fraud indicators

AI fraud detection software developers create an engine that instantly assigns a fraud risk score to every transaction based on detected risk indicators. A real-time risk scoring engine can automatically approve, block, or send suspicious transactions for manual review.

5:Integrate Automated Fraud Response Systems

In this development phase, the dedicated software development team set up an automated fraud response. Integrating this allows the system to instantly block suspicious activities, approve low-risk transactions, and send medium-risk cases for manual review.

It’s an important phase because it reduces manual workload for fraud teams and improves response speed during high transaction volumes. Meanwhile, businesses minimize financial losses while maintaining a smooth customer experience.

6:Enable Continuous Learning and Model Improvement

Develop an AI fraud detection software that can continuously learn from new fraud attempts, customer behavior, and investigation results. This helps the system improve detection accuracy over time.

Top fraud detection software developers create a model that helps the platform adapt to evolving fraud techniques without requiring constant manual rule updates. This allows enterprises to ensure faster threat detection and better long-term fraud prevention.

7:Implement Security and Compliance Measures

Before heading towards the testing phase, the team implements security and compliance measures into the solution. They ensure protecting sensitive financial data with encryption, audit logs, access controls, and compliance standards such as GDPR, PCI-DSS, KYC, and AML regulations.

This helps enterprises prevent unauthorized access, data breaches, and financial manipulation during transactions. Integrating strong compliance frameworks builds customer trust and reduces legal and regulatory risks.

8:Test the Platform Across Real Fraud Scenarios

In this development phase, the quality assurance team tests the AI fraud detection software using real-world fraud simulations to evaluate

  • Detection accuracy
  • False positives
  • Response time
  • System stability

Testing helps in identifying security vulnerabilities, performance bottlenecks, and integration issues before launching the system. It ensures the system performs reliably under real-time transaction loads and evolving fraud scenarios.

9:Launch, Monitor, and Continuously Optimize

Once the QA team confirms with testing, it’s time to deploy the fraud prevention software. The team helps in deploying the software and continuously monitors fraud trends, model performance, and customer behavior. The team also considers regular updates and training to help the platform stay effective against evolving fraud techniques.

Monitoring also helps enterprises identify new fraud patterns and improve system performance. It ultimately ensures the platform remains reliable, scalable, and effective as transaction volumes continue to grow.

Let’s discover some of the essential frameworks that are required to build an AI fraud detection system in 2026.

Tech Stack Required for AI Fraud Detection Software Development

Indeed, the performance of AI-powered fraud detection platforms depends on the technologies used in creating the system. Every technology layer, like secure cloud infrastructure or real time data processing, is foremost to detect fraud accurately.

Picking the right framework is important because it helps enterprises develop high performing, scalable, and secure fraud detection software. A system that can handle millions of transactions without compromising speed or accuracy.

Analyze the table to understand different types of frameworks that are required for different purposes:

Technology AreaRequired Tech Stack (Frameworks)Purpose
Programming languagesPython, Java, ScalaBuild fraud detection algorithms and backend systems
Machine learning frameworksTensorFlow, PyTorch, Scikit-learnTrain and deploy fraud detection models
Frontend developmentReact, Angular, Vue.jsBuild monitoring dashboards and admin panels
Backend developmentNode.js, Django, Spring BootHandle APIs, workflows, and transaction processing
Real-time data processingApache Kafka, Apache SparkProcess live transactions and streaming data
Database managementPostgreSQL, MongoDB, CassandraStore customer, transaction, and fraud data
Cloud infrastructureAWS, Microsoft Azure, Google CloudDeploy scalable and secure fraud detection systems
Big data technologiesHadoop, Apache FlinkAnalyze large-scale transaction datasets
Security and complianceOAuth 2.0, AES Encryption, JWTProtect sensitive financial and customer data
API integrationREST APIs, GraphQLConnect banking systems, payment gateways, and third-party services
Monitoring and analyticsGrafana, Kibana, PrometheusMonitor fraud activity and system performance
DevOps and deploymentDocker, Kubernetes, JenkinsAutomate deployment and system scaling

Key Features of an Enterprise AI Fraud Detection Platform

Businesses are seeking to develop a real-time fraud detection solution that integrates with artificial intelligence (AI) to detect suspicious behavior and adjust to changing fraud trends by 2026. This is possible with advanced AI features along with basic core features. The top 10 features that must be incorporated into your fraud prevention software are as follows:

  • Real-Time Transaction Monitoring

Investigates and tracks transactions and user activity in real-time for suspicious activity.

  • Behavioral Analytics

Monitors and determines unusual action and spending patterns of consumers, login activity and device usage.

  • AI-Based Risk Scoring

Uses fraud indicators, transaction history, and user behavior to assign a dynamic risk score to each transaction.

  • Automated Fraud Response

Automatically blocks, approves or flags transactions for manual review according to the level of fraud risk profile detected.

  • Device Fingerprinting

Monitors any device, browser and login activities to detect any unauthorized access.

  • Multi-Layer Authentication Support

Strengthens security with OTP verification, biometric authentication, and multi-factor authentication methods.

  • Anomaly Detection

Identifies hidden fraud patterns, abnormal transactions, and suspicious activities that traditional rule-based systems often miss.

  • Real-Time Alerts and Notifications

Sends instant alerts to fraud teams and customers whenever suspicious activities are detected.

  • Compliance and Data Security

Supports compliance standards like PCI-DSS, GDPR, KYC, and AML while protecting sensitive financial data through encryption and access controls.

  • Scalable Cloud Infrastructure

Handles millions of transactions efficiently while maintaining speed, accuracy, and system stability during high traffic volumes.

Rule-Based vs AI Fraud Detection Systems

Earlier, rule-based enterprise fraud detection systems were built to detect predefined fraud patterns using fixed conditions and manual rules. But today modern fraud techniques change rapidly, which makes it daunting for static systems to detect unwanted activities accurately.

As a result, enterprises are investing in intelligent AI fraud detection software development to analyze behavior in real time and reduce false positives. Let’s discover how an AI-based system is different from the old detection system.

FactorRule-Based Fraud DetectionAI-Powered Fraud Detection
Detection MethodFollows a set schedule and rulesInterprets behavior and transaction patterns
Fraud AdaptabilityOnly works with pre-defined fraud scenariosContinuously adapts to new fraud techniques
False PositivesHigher false alertsReduced false positives
Detection SpeedBut slower for more intricate fraudsIdentifies unusual activity as it happens
ScalabilityDifficult to manage at large scaleProcesses large amounts of transactions efficiently
MaintenanceNeeds regular updates to rules by handOpens up to new data and continually improves
Customer ExperienceMay frequently block legitimate transactionsOffers smoother & accurate verification

Types of Fraud AI Can Detect

Today’s AI-powered fraud prevention software can easily identify suspicious activities across multiple channels, transactions, and customer interactions in real-time. The most common types of fraud AI can detect for enterprises include

  • Payment Fraud

Identifies unapproved payments to stop financial losses, stolen cards and suspicious transactions.

  • Account Takeover Fraud

Detects unauthorized logon attempts, abnormal account usage, and suspicious access.

  • Identity Theft

Notices when personal information is used fraudulently to open an account, make transactions, or verify accounts.

  • Synthetic Identity Fraud

Recognizes fake identities using a combination of real and fake information that are used to open fraudulent accounts.

  • Insurance Fraud

Identifies fraudulent claims, duplicate claims, and unusual activities of policyholders within an insurance network.

  • Transaction Laundering

Traps fraudulent or illegal transactions that are executed with a legitimate merchant account.

  • Friendly Fraud

Reports false charges when customers dispute legitimate charges after obtaining goods or services.

  • Loan and Credit Fraud

Identifies fraud in loans, financial history, and borrower activity.

  • Insider Fraud

Detects any unusual employee behaviour, activity or access to sensitive financial systems or systems, or any other internal misuse.

  • Phishing and Social Engineering Fraud

Detects unusual behavior patterns linked to compromised accounts and fraud attempts caused by phishing attacks.

How Much Does AI Fraud Detection Software Development Cost?

As of 2026, the cost to build fraud prevention software is estimated between $80,000 and $300,000 or even more, depending on the complexity of the project. The pricing also depends on

  • AI model complexity and training
  • System architecture and integrations
  • Regulatory and compliance requirements
  • Development team and timeline
  • Deployment and ongoing maintenance

Analyze the table below to understand the cost estimate based on complexity:

Software ComplexityEstimated CostEstimated Timeline
Basic Fraud Detection Platform$50,000-$80,0003-4 months
Mid-Level Fraud Detection Platform$80,000-$200,0004-8 months
Complex Fraud Detection Platform$200,000-300,0000+Up to 1 year

Conclusion

You understand that enterprises now no longer rely on outdated rule-based systems that struggle to detect modern threats as financial fraud continues to grow.

This is making enterprises invest in AI fraud detection software development so that they can identify suspicious activities faster and improve customer trust. All this happens without compromising security.

However, developing an effective fraud prevention system is not only about detection accuracy. Enterprises also need strong governance, compliance, transparency, and responsible risk management to ensure long-term reliability.

With the right technology strategy and AI governance company, like Apptunix, for building fraud detection software in place, you can stay resilient against evolving financial threats while maintaining operational efficiency and customer confidence.

Apptunix helps enterprises by developing secure, scalable, and governance-focused AI solutions tailored for modern fraud prevention needs.

So don’t get behind. Use the full potential of AI to detect fraud and prevent your company from big losses.